7 Indications Your Garage Door Needs Expert Repair Work in Perth.
Your garage door is one of the most often used functions of your home. You may open and close it several times a day without giving it much thought. When your garage door starts behaving differently, it could be cautioning you that a repair work is required.
Ignoring small problems can permit wear and damage to infect other components. What starts as a loud roller or slow opening system might ultimately lead to a door that ends up being stuck or hazardous to run.
For house owners in Perth, regular garage door upkeep is particularly essential. Garage doors are exposed to strong sunshine, dust, wind, temperature level changes and, in coastal locations, salted air. These conditions can contribute to progressive wear and deterioration.
Acknowledging the caution signs early can assist you arrange professional repair work before a small concern ends up being a significant problem.

Garage doors naturally make some noise when they operate, but unexpected or unusually loud sounds ought to not be ignored. If your door has ended up being noticeably louder than typical, there may be an issue with several of its moving components.
Grinding, shrieking, popping, banging, rattling and consistent squeaking can all suggest potential issues. For example, grinding may be associated with worn rollers or problems with the tracks, while a loud popping sound can in some cases show an issue with a garage door spring.
In some cases, a squeaky garage door might merely require appropriate lubrication. If lubrication does not solve the sound or the sound keeps returning, there might be underlying wear that needs professional attention.
It is essential not to dismantle or change springs and cables yourself. These elements can be under considerable tension and incorrect handling can trigger serious injury.
An expert garage door service technician can inspect the moving parts and identify the source of the noise. Resolving the issue early may also help avoid damage to other parts.
A properly working garage door must move efficiently and remain fairly level as it takes a trip along its tracks. If one side of the door increases faster than the other or the door appears misaligned throughout operation, there could be a problem with the balance or positioning of the system.
You might notice that a person side sits higher than the other when the door is open. The bottom of the door might likewise stop working to satisfy the ground evenly when it closes. In some cases, the door might shake, drag or appear to move at an angle.
A number of elements might add to this issue, including springs, cable televisions, rollers or tracks. Continuing to operate an irregular door can put additional pressure on the automatic opener and other mechanical parts.
A professional specialist can examine the whole system instead of simply changing the most apparent component. This is essential because garage doors count on several interconnected parts to run properly.
If your garage door no longer moves equally, setting up an evaluation can help identify the issue before the door becomes completely stuck.
Another typical caution sign is a garage door that has ended up being significantly slower than it used to be. If your door takes significantly longer to open or close, thinks twice before moving or appears to struggle throughout operation, it should be inspected.
A sluggish garage door can have numerous possible causes. The tracks may need attention, the rollers might be used, the springs may be losing their effectiveness or the automated opener may be experiencing an issue.
Focus on changes in how the door sounds and moves. If the motor appears to be working more difficult than usual or the door stops and starts during operation, continuing to use it without identifying the cause could result in additional wear.
Your garage door opener is created to operate a correctly balanced door. When the door becomes much heavier or harder to move, the opener may need to work harder to lift it.
With time, this additional stress can add to premature wear of the opener and other elements.
An expert evaluation can determine whether the problem is related to the opener itself or another part of the garage door system.
If your garage door begins closing after you have actually fully opened it, this is a serious caution sign. An appropriately functioning door should have the ability to stay open without all of a sudden dropping or gradually moving towards the ground.
The garage door spring system plays an important role in reversing the weight of the door. When springs end up being used or harmed, the door can become much heavier and more challenging to control.
You might see that the door feels unusually heavy when operated manually or that it starts to drop after reaching the open position.
A faulty spring can likewise place additional strain on the garage door opener. In some scenarios, continued usage can result in more damage to the door or opener.
Garage door springs must not be fixed or changed as a DIY task. They can keep a significant amount of energy, and inaccurate handling can trigger severe injuries.
If your door can not stay open safely, stop using it where possible and get in touch with a professional garage door technician for an inspection.
A garage door that repeatedly gets stuck is another clear sign that something is wrong. The door may stop midway, refuse to open completely or end up being stuck at a particular point during its motion.
In other cases, the door might behave inconsistently and stop at different positions.
Potential causes can consist of harmed tracks, used rollers, cable issues, spring problems, obstructions or faults with the automatic opener. For automated garage doors, problems with the safety sensors can likewise impact the door's ability to close.
Before setting up a repair, you can inspect whether there is an apparent things obstructing the door's path. You can also ensure the location around the security sensors is clear.
If there is no apparent obstruction and the issue continues, professional assessment is suggested.
Consistently forcing a garage door to open or close can position extra pressure on its elements. What begins as a fairly small fault can become more complex if the door continues operating under irregular conditions.
Some garage door problems can be recognized through a basic visual evaluation. You may see a damaged cable, bent track, split roller, rusted part, loose bracket or harmed door panel.
Visible damage ought to not be disregarded, especially if it impacts an element accountable for supporting or managing the movement of the door.
For instance, a frayed cable can become more harmed with time and may eventually break. A bent track can affect how smoothly the rollers move, while harmed rollers can increase friction and noise.
Perth's climate can also add to degeneration. Strong UV direct exposure can impact particular products and surfaces, while moisture and salty air may contribute to corrosion, especially for residential or commercial properties situated closer to the coast.
If you observe a part that looks harmed, prevent trying to correct, get rid of or repair it yourself. A professional service technician can identify whether the part can be repaired or requires to be changed.
Identifying noticeable wear early can assist prevent a more significant failure later on.
Modern automatic garage doors consist of safety functions created to decrease the risk of mishaps. If your door all of a sudden reverses, declines to close effectively or acts differently from regular, it should be investigated.
For example, the door may begin closing and then instantly reverse. It might stop before reaching the ground, run intermittently or fail to react consistently to the remote.
Safety sensors can sometimes be accountable for uncommon behaviour. If sensing units become dirty, misaligned or blocked, the door may discover an apparent obstruction and reverse.
Unforeseeable operation can likewise be caused by problems with the opener, circuitry, remote controls or mechanical components.
Do not bypass or disable safety functions merely to make the door run. These systems are created to secure people, pets and home.
If your garage door is acting unexpectedly, a specialist can evaluate the opener, sensing units and mechanical elements to determine the underlying cause.
When Should You Call a Garage Door Expert?
Understanding when to organize a repair work can help prevent a minor issue from becoming a significant failure.
If your garage door has actually all of a sudden become loud, slow, unequal or challenging to operate, it deserves having it evaluated. The same applies if you observe noticeable damage, a broken spring, a damaged cable television or a door that consistently gets stuck.
Issues including springs, cable televisions, tracks and other mechanical elements should normally be dealt with by an experienced specialist. These parts can support substantial weight and, in many cases, stay under substantial stress even when the door is not moving.
Expert repair work can also assist determine the origin of the problem instead of merely resolving the sign.
For example, replacing a used roller might deal with extreme noise, however if the roller has actually been using too soon because the track is misaligned, the underlying problem likewise needs to be resolved.
Can You Fix a Garage Door Yourself?
There are some basic garage door upkeep tasks that house owners can carry out, such as keeping the location around the door clear and looking for apparent obstructions.
Nevertheless, more complex repair work should be delegated a certified garage door specialist.
Springs, cable televisions, brackets and other parts can be under significant tension. Attempting to adjust or replace these parts without the appropriate training and devices can result in severe injury.
A professional technician has the tools and experience required to examine the total garage door system and determine the most safe repair method.
This is particularly crucial when the door is heavy, damaged or no longer running generally.
How Regular Garage Door Upkeep Can Help
You do not need to wait till your garage door quits working in the past setting up an inspection.
Regular maintenance can assist recognize worn parts before they fail. A specialist can examine the condition of the springs, cables, rollers, tracks, hinges, brackets, security sensors and automated opener.
Regular attention can likewise assist keep smooth operation and possibly extend the working life of your garage door components.
Homeowners can also pay attention to changes in the door's behaviour. If it begins making a brand-new sound, moving more gradually or requiring more effort to operate, these modifications must not be dismissed.
Early intervention can in some cases prevent a relatively uncomplicated repair work from turning into a bigger and more pricey issue.
